Riga post office No. 50 will continue operations in the current premises in the shopping centre Origo for the time being

Due to previously unforeseen technical reasons Riga post office No. 50 will continue its operations in the existing premises in the shopping centre Origo at 2 Stacijas laukums for the time being, postponing relocation to new premises at the current address near entrance D to the shopping centre. As soon as the date of the move of premises of Riga post office No. 50 is known, Latvijas Pasts will immediately provide public information.

Latvijas Pasts previously announced that from the 3rd of November 2020 Riga post office No. 50 will start its operations in new and reconstructed premises at the current address: shopping centre Origo, 2 Stacijas laukums. Due to technical reasons Riga post office No. 50 will continue to work in the existing premises in the shopping centre Origo for now, offering customers postal services every workday from 7 AM to 9 PM, on Saturdays from 9 AM to 8 PM and on Sundays from 10 AM to 8 PM, as before.

As soon as precise information about the opening of the new premises near entrance D to the shopping centre Origo is known, Latvijas Pasts will notify its customers. In the new premises Riga post office No. 50 will offer customers a range of press publications and other retail goods in modern open-type stands.

About SJSC Latvijas Pasts
Latvijas Pasts ensures the widest availability of postal services throughout Latvia by maintaining more than 600 post offices. The primary function of the company is provision of the universal postal service; Latvijas Pasts also provides commercial transport, express mail, payment, press subscription, retail and philatelic services. Latvijas Pasts is a wholly State-owned company with about 3,200 employees. The quality measurements of Latvijas Pasts domestic mail deliveries are regularly conducted by Kantar TNS, one of the leading market, social and media research agencies in Latvia. In turn, the quality measurements of the cross-border deliveries are provided within the framework of the International Post Corporation through the intermediary of the research companies Kantar TNS, Ipsos and Quotas.
